JOB OVERVIEW


Ontario Power Generation (OPG) is looking for a dynamic, strategic and results-driven professional to join our team in the role of Electrical & Control Technician/Technologist.


Reporting to the Trades Management Supervisor, this position is responsible to maintain and overhaul all electrical/ electronic/control/protection/telecommunication associated with a thermal generating station and facilities.

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ES

  • Install, commission, inspect, troubleshoot, service, maintain and overhaul and assist with the design for all electrical/ electronic/control/protection/telecommunication or testing equipment, associated with generating stations and facilities. Take appropriate preventative or corrective action.
  • Prepare electrical, control, instrumentation, protection and telecommunication sketches, drawings, and bills of material. Carry out document maintenance activities.
  • Co-ordinate large projects or highly complex maintenance enhancements related to the installation of new electrical systems, or the replacement of existing systems with different technologies.
  • Carry out contract coordination and inspections to ensure effective quality assurance.
  • Assist in the design of Programmable Logic Controllers (PLC) programs as required for the efficient operation of the station. Experience in programming Allen Bradely.
  • Experience in networked PLC\'s related to PLC maintenance, configuration, programming, testing, control systems expertise, troubleshooting field devices alarms/ failures.
  • Experience in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(Foxboro I/A), specifically integration, screen and tag modifications and verification of end devices interfacing with SCADA.
  • Experience with communications related to PLC\'s, SCADA, Protections and Metering to troubleshoot communication failures to networked equipment.
  • Setup, install, programming and connecting of servers/ network switches/ modems/ routes/ gateways. Installation, repairs and commissioning of new network cables..
  • Commission, programming, and perform field testing on various protection relays used in the power industry (GE, BECKWITH, SEL etc.) Install, commission, inspect and test High Voltage (HV) Equipment including; HV Breakers and HV Transformers.
  • Carry out a variety of measurements including testing of electrical, control and protection equipment to recognized standards and procedures.
  • Determine generating system reliability and power system production. Develop and maintain supplementary computer programs to facilitate analysis.
  • Participate in studies associated with energy production, load and capacity, demand management, etc., and provide regular and on- demand reports. Establish and maintain documentation / program files.
  • Perform Level 5 Work Protection activities.
  • Provide technical support, advice, coordination and assistance with regard to emerging work, projects and daily routines, including the development of technical/operational solutions to problems.
  • Prepare and modify technical procedures and standards and generate reports.
  • Accountable for the health, safety & well being of self and others, in accordance with technical/operating procedures and standards, and includes the development of technical/ operating solutions to problems.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• Valid Certificate of Qualification (309A/D or 442A) preffered.
  • Valid Certificate of Qualification (447A) is considered an asset.
  • 5+ years of experience as an electrician in a maintenance setting.
  • Experience programming and troubleshooting Allen Bradely using control logix is considered an asset.
  • Experience programming and troubleshooting Foxboro I/A using control Archestra is considered an asset.
  • Experience programming and troubleshooting Ovation is considered an asset.
  • Ability to work at heights and in confined spaces.
  • Ability to operate equipment such as elevated work platform.
  • Ability to work in hot and cold temperatures and environments.
  • Minimum a G class driver\xe2\x80\x99s license in good standing.
